Job DescriptionThe Registered Nurse (RN) plays a vital role in providing comprehensive, patient-centered care within our multidisciplinary health team. This position supports CFHC’s mission by delivering high-quality, evidence-based nursing care; coordinating health services across acute, chronic, and preventive care; and fostering long‑term wellness through health education and patient advocacy.
Working collaboratively with medical providers, behavioral health, and care coordination staff, the RN ensures that each patient receives personalized support — from maternity care and family planning to chronic disease management and health promotion. The RN will perform clinical assessments, dispense prescribed birth control per protocol, manage care transitions, and coach patients toward self‑management goals.
This role also emphasizes proactive engagement with patients and families, integrating home visits, case conferencing, and data‑driven quality improvement initiatives.
